I should've been more clear, that's not what I meant. All houses I have downloaded always only have one package because I only download no cc houses, what I meant though, the lot names in game are often missing. So when you go in game and look at the houses bin, some of them don't have any name, like  "Das Winzig Haus" or "Hagrid's Hut". Some lots I have extracted retained their in game names but the others are nameless. Hope that makes sense.


That happens to me even when I install lots in sims3packs with the launcher. I don't think the package extractor is doing that.


Ah :-\ Any idea how to fix that? I mean, can we manually edit the file in s3pe to add the lot name? It's getting annoying.


It's from the person uploading not putting a name on the lot with the in-game editor. If people would do that, it wouldn't be an issue. The only fix is to edit the information onto the lot yourself while in game.
